如何从 SQL Developer 备份 Oracle 数据库

thu*_*con 9 oracle-12c

Oracle 新手,通常使用 SQL Server。

是否有一种简单的方法可以从 SQL Developer 备份 Oracle 数据库。

我已经阅读了这些链接数据库备份和恢复用户指南RMAN,这是一个疯狂的过程!一定有更简单的方法,对吧?

Joh*_* N. 9

不。然后是。这要看情况。

你有什么要求?

备份/恢复功能

是否要备份数据库...

  • ... 恢复
  • ... 执行恢复
  • ...前滚额外的存档日志

那么 RMAN 是您的首选工具。是的,RMAN 非常复杂,学习曲线陡峭。但是,一旦掌握了它,您将受益于 RMAN 为您提供的多种可能性,例如用于多个 Oracle 实例的中央 RMAN 目录

导出/导入功能

你想要一个数据库的转储....

  • ...“恢复”到新的服务器/实例
  • ...无需恢复
  • ...没有额外的归档日志前滚

...那么您可能需要考虑使用 EXPDP(请参阅:数据泵导出)和 IMPDP(请参阅:数据泵导入)。这些工具使您能够获取特定于模式的数据并将数据导入不同的表空间;或者通过表名、依赖项过滤导出。在导入时,可以将架构重新链接到不同的架构(请参阅:REMAP_SCHEMA)等。

SQL 开发人员

SQL Developer 能够使用向导导出数据。这类似于随 RDBMS 安装提供的内置 EXPDP 和 IMPDP 工具。可以在以下位置找到使用该向导的快速指南:导出和导入元数据和数据以及使用 SQL Developer 进行导出和导入(工具 | 数据库导出)部分。